Detailed Explanation

Backlash error occurs when there is a looseness in the screw-nut fit, affecting measurement precision as stated in the context. The pitch of the screw is defined as the distance moved by the screw for one complete rotation, which is critical for accurate measurement. The circular scale indicates the divisions, while the linear scale provides consistency in reading measurements.
